TL-IS200-4G2F4SC-4RS is a TP-LINK managed industrial switch designed for industrial environments. It provides 4 Gigabit adaptive RJ45 ports, 2 Gigabit SFP ports, 4 pairs of Gigabit single-mode dual-fiber SC fiber ports, and 4 RS-232/485 serial ports
-40°C~85°C working temperature design, no fear of extreme temperatures
TL-IS200-4G2F4SC-4RS is designed in strict accordance with the working temperature of -40°C~85°C (ambient wind speed 240LFM) and -40°C~75°C (natural heat dissipation).
Industrial-grade protection design
High-standard electromagnetic anti-interference protection design, suitable for various harsh electromagnetic environments such as electric power and industrial plants.
Electroless nickel gold PCB board greatly improves the corrosion resistance of the equipment.
Conformal coating protection to improve the reliability of industrial-grade products.
9.6V~60VDC wide voltage input
It supports simultaneous access of three power supplies, and the power supply is redundant to ensure the uninterrupted work of the equipment.
It supports a wide voltage input of 9.6V~60VDC, and is suitable for various industrial power supplies.
Three types of power protection are provided to greatly improve the reliability of power supply to the switch.

Steel shell body, sturdy and durable, efficient heat dissipation
It adopts steel shell structure, which is strong and durable, and has high strength. The steel shell design naturally dissipates heat, which can ensure the stable operation of the product without fan, and is noiseless and quiet, and adapts to various harsh industrial environments.
DIN rail installation is easy and flexible
It can be easily installed on DIN rails and wall-mounted, making the use of industrial-grade switches simple and reliable.

Industrial field serial port access, fast data collection and transmission
It can support standard communication interface protocols such as RS-232/485, support Modbus RTU to TCP, realize the access of serial port equipment in industrial sites to IP network, ensure the rapid collection and transmission of field data, and help the centralized processing of business data.
Simple and practical network management functions
It supports the management and maintenance of the device through the web interface and PC management software.
802.1Q VLAN, MTU VLAN, and port VLAN are supported, allowing users to flexibly divide VLANs according to their needs.
It supports QoS and three priority modes based on ports, 802.1P, and DSCP to optimize bandwidth configuration.
Port aggregation is supported, which effectively increases link bandwidth, implements link backup, and improves link reliability.
Port mirroring is supported, and data from a port is forwarded to the mirrored port for network monitoring.
Port monitoring is supported, and the traffic information of each port is counted to facilitate traffic monitoring and network anomaly analysis.
It supports bandwidth control, configures port data input/output transmission rates, and reasonably allocates and utilizes bandwidth.
Storm suppression is supported to limit the broadcast traffic allowed to be received by the port to prevent broadcast storms from seriously slowing down network performance.
